Nonagenarians and centenarians represent a quickly growing age group worldwide. In parallel, the prevalence of dementia increases substantially, but how to define dementia in this oldest-old age segment remains unclear. Although the idea that the risk of Alzheimer's disease (AD) decreases after age 90 has now been questioned, the oldest-old still represent a population relatively resistant to degenerative brain processes. Brain aging is characterised by the formation of neurofibrillary tangles (NFTs) and senile plaques (SPs) as well as neuronal and synaptic loss in both cognitively intact individuals and patients with AD. In nondemented cases NFTs are usually restricted to the hippocampal formation, whereas the progressive involvement of the association areas in the temporal neocortex parallels the development of overt clinical signs of dementia. In contrast, there is little correlation between the quantitative distribution of SP and AD severity. The pattern of lesion distribution and neuronal loss changes in extreme aging relative to the younger-old. In contrast to younger cases where dementia is mainly related to severe NFT formation within adjacent components of the medial and inferior aspects of the temporal cortex, oldest-old individuals display a preferential involvement of the anterior part of the CA1 field of the hippocampus whereas the inferior temporal and frontal association areas are relatively spared. This pattern suggests that both the extent of NFT development in the hippocampus as well as a displacement of subregional NFT distribution within the Cornu ammonis (CA) fields may be key determinants of dementia in the very old. Cortical association areas are relatively preserved. The progression of NFT formation across increasing cognitive impairment was significantly slower in nonagenarians and centenarians compared to younger cases in the CA1 field and entorhinal cortex. The total amount of amyloid and the neuronal loss in these regions were also significantly lower than those reported in younger AD cases. Overall, there is evidence that pathological substrates of cognitive deterioration in the oldest-old are different from those observed in the younger-old. Microvascular parameters such as mean capillary diameters may be key factors to consider for the prediction of cognitive decline in the oldest-old. Neuropathological particularities of the oldest-old may be related to "longevity-enabling" genes although little or nothing is known in this promising field of future research.

Acute cases of schistosomiasis have been found on the coastal area of Pernambuco, Brazil, due to environmental disturbances and disorderly occupation of the urban areas. This study identifies and spatially marks the main foci of the snail host species, Biomphalaria glabrata on Itamaracá Island. The chaotic occupation of the beach resorts has favoured the emergence of transmission foci, thus exposing residents and tourists to the risk of infection. A database covering five years of epidemiological investigation on snails infected by Schistosoma mansoni in the island was produced with information from the geographic positioning of the foci, number of snails collected, number of snails tested positive, and their infection rate. The spatial position of the foci were recorded through the Global Positioning System (GPS), and the geographical coordinates were imported by AutoCad. The software packages ArcView and Spring were used for data processing and spatial analysis. AutoCad 2000 was used to plot the pairs of coordinates obtained from GPS. Between 1998 and 2002 5009 snails, of which 12.2% were positive for S. mansoni, were collected in Forte Beach. A total of 27 foci and areas of environmental risk were identified and spatially analyzed allowing the identification of the areas exposed to varying degrees of risk.

Public Policy and Ageing in Northern Ireland: Identifying Levers for Change Judith Cross, Policy Officer with the Centre for Ageing Research Development in Ireland (CARDI)��������Introduction Identifying a broad range of key public policy initiatives as they relate to age can facilitate discussion and create new knowledge within and across government to maximise the opportunities afforded by an ageing population. This article looks at how examining the current public policy frameworks in Northern Ireland can present opportunities for those working in this field for the benefit of older people. Good policy formulation needs to be evidence-based, flexible, innovative and look beyond institutional boundaries. Bringing together architects and occupational therapists, for example, has the potential to create better and more effective ways relevant to health, housing, social services and government departments. Traditional assumptions of social policy towards older people have tended to be medically focused with an emphasis on care and dependency. This in turn has consequences for the design and delivery of services for older people. It is important that these assumptions are challenged as changes in thinking and attitudes can lead to a redefinition of ageing, resulting in policies and practices that benefit older people now and in the future. Older people, their voices and experiences, need to be central to these developments. The Centre for Ageing Research and Development in Ireland The Centre for Ageing Research and Development in Ireland (CARDI) (1) is a not for profit organisation developed by leaders from the ageing field across Ireland (North and South) including age sector focused researchers and academics, statutory and voluntary, and is co-chaired by Professor Robert Stout and Professor Davis Coakley. CARDI has been established to provide a mechanism for greater collaboration among age researchers, for wider dissemination of ageing research information and to advance a research agenda relevant to the needs of older people in Ireland, North and South. Operating at a strategic level and in an advisory capacity, CARDI�۪s work focuses on promoting research co-operation across sectors and disciplines and concentrates on influencing the strategic direction of research into older people and ageing in Ireland. It has been strategically positioned around the following four areas: Identifying and establishing ageing research priorities relevant to policy and practice in Ireland, North and South;Promoting greater collaboration and co-operation on ageing research in order to build an ageing research community in Ireland, North and South;Stimulating research in priority areas that can inform policy and practice relating to ageing and older people in Ireland, North and South;Communicating strategic research issues on ageing to raise the profile of ageing research in Ireland, North and South, and its role in informing policy and practice. Context of Ageing in Ireland Ireland �۪s population is ageing. One million people aged 60 and over now live on the island of Ireland. By 2031, it is expected that Northern Ireland�۪s percentage of older people will increase to 28% and the Republic of Ireland�۪s to 23%. The largest increase will be in the older old; the number aged 80+ is expected to triple by the same date. However while life expectancy has increased, it is not clear that life without disability and ill health has increased to the same extent. A growing number of older people may face the combined effects of a decline in physical and mental function, isolation and poverty. Policymakers, service providers and older people alike recognise the need to create a high quality of life for our ageing population. This challenge can be meet by addressing the problems relating to healthy ageing, reducing inequalities in later life and creating services that are shaped by, and appropriate for, older people. Devolution and Structures of Government in Northern Ireland The Agreement (2) reached in the Multi-Party Negotiations in Belfast 1998 established the Northern Ireland Assembly which has full legislative authority for all transferred matters. The majority of social and economic public policy such as; agriculture, arts, education, health, environment and planning is determined by the Northern Ireland Assembly at Stormont. There are 11 Government Departments covering the main areas of responsibility with 108 elected Members of the Legislative Assembly (MLA�۪s). The powers of the Northern Ireland Assembly do not cover ��� reserved�۪ matters or ��� excepted�۪ matters . These are the responsibility of Westminster and include issues such as, tax, social security, policing, justice, defence, immigration and foreign affairs. Northern Ireland has 18 elected Members of Parliament (MP�۪s) to the House of Commons. Public Policy Context in Northern Ireland The economic, social and political consequence of an ageing population is a challenge for policy makers across government. Considering the complex and diverse causal factors that contribute to ageing in Northern Ireland, there are a number of areas of government policy at regional, national and international levels that are likely to impact in this area. International The Madrid International Plan of Action on Ageing (3) and the Research Agenda on Ageing for the 21st Century (4) provide important mechanisms for furthering research into ageing. The United Kingdom has signed up to these. The Madrid International Plan of Action on Ageing commits member states to a systematic review of the Plan of Action through Regional Implementation Strategies. The United Kingdom�۪s Regional Implementation Strategy covers Northern Ireland. National At National level, pension and social security are high on the agenda. The Pensions Act (5) became law in 2007 and links pensions increases with earnings as opposed to prices from 2012. Additional credits for people raising children and caring for older people to boost their pensions were introduced. Some protections are included for those who lost occupational pensions as a result of underfunded schemes being wound up before April 2005. In relation to State Pensions and benefits, this Act will bring changes to state pensions in future. The Act now places the Pension Credit element which is up-rated in line with or above earnings, on a permanent, statutory footing. Regional At regional level there are a number of age related public policy initiatives that have the potential to impact positively on the lives of older people in Northern Ireland. Some are specific to ageing such as the Ageing in an Inclusive Society (6) and others by their nature are cross-cutting such as Lifetime Opportunities: Governments Anti-Poverty Strategy for Northern Ireland (7). The main public policy framework in Northern Ireland is the Programme for Government: Building a Better Future, 2008-2011(PfG) (8) . The PfG, is the overarching high level policy framework for Northern Ireland and provides useful principles for ageing research and public policy in Northern Ireland. The PfG vision is to build a peaceful, fair and prosperous society in Northern Ireland, with respect for the rule of law. A number of Public Service Agreements (PSA) aligned to the PfG confirm key actions that will be taken to support the priorities that the Government aim to achieve over the next three years. For example objective 2 of PSA 7: Making Peoples�۪ Lives Better: Drive a programme across Government to reduce poverty and address inequality and disadvantage, refers to taking forward strategic action to promote social inclusion for older people; and to deliver a strong independent voice for older people. The Office of the First Minister and deputy First Minister (OFMDFM) have recently appointed an Interim Older People�۪s Advocate, Dame Joan Harbison to provide a focus for older peoples issues across Government. Ageing in an Inclusive Society is the cross-departmental strategy for older people in Northern Ireland and was launched in March 2005. It sets out the approach to be taken across Government to promote and support the inclusion of older people. The vision coupled with six strategic objectives form the basis of the action plans accompanying the strategy. The vision is: ���To ensure that age related policies and practices create an enabling environment, which offers everyone the opportunity to make informed choices so that they may pursue healthy, active and positive ageing.� (Ageing in an Inclusive Society, Office of the First Minister and Deputy First Minister, 2005) Action planning and maintaining momentum across government in relation to this strategy has proved to be slower than anticipated. It is proposed to refresh this Strategy in line with Opportunity Age ��� meeting the challenges of ageing in the 21st Century (9). There are a number of policy levers elsewhere which can also be used to promote the positive aspects of an ageing society. The Investing for Health (10) and A Healthier Future:A 20 Year Vision for Health and Well-being in Northern Ireland (11), seek to ensure that the overall vision for health and wellbeing is achievable and provides a useful framework for ageing policy and research in the health area. These health initiatives have the potential to positively impact on the quality of life of older people and provide a useful framework for improving current policy and practice. In addition to public policy initiatives, the anti-discrimination frameworks in terms of employment in Northern Ireland cover age as well as a range of other grounds. Goods facilitates and services are currently excluded from the Employment Equality (age) Regulations (NI) 2006 (12). Supplementing the anti-discrimination measures, Section 75 of the Northern Ireland Act 1998 (13), unique to Northern Ireland, places a statutory obligation on public authorities in fulfilling their functions to promote equality of opportunity across nine grounds, one of which is age(14). This positive duty has the potential to make a real difference to the lives of older people in Northern Ireland. Those affected by policy decisions must be consulted and their interests taken into account. This provides an opportunity for older people and their representatives to participate in public policy-making, right from the start of the process. After more than 40 years of clinical use, levodopa (LD) remains the gold standard of symptomatic efficacy in the drug treatment of Parkinson's disease (PD). Compared with other available dopaminergic therapies, dopamine replacement with LD is associated with the greatest improvement in motor function. Long-term treatment with LD is, however, often complicated by the development of various types of motor response oscillations over the day, as well as drug-induced dyskinesias. Motor fluctuations can be improved by the addition of drugs such as entacapone or monoamine oxidase inhibitors, which extend the half-life of levodopa or dopamine, respectively. However, dyskinesia control still represents a major challenge. As a result, many neurologists have become cautious when prescribing therapy with LD. This review summarizes the available evidence regarding the use of LD to treat PD and will also address the issue of LD delivery as a critical factor for the drug's propensity to induce motor complications.

Total energy expenditure (TEE) and patterns of activity were measured by means of a heart rate (HR)-monitoring method in a group of 8-10-year-old children including 13 obese children (weight, 46 +/- 10 kg; fat mass: 32 +/- 9%) and 16 nonobese children (weight, 31 +/- 5 kg; fat mass, 18 +/- 5%). Time for sleeping was not statistically different in the two groups of children (596 +/- 33 vs. 582 +/- 43 min; p = NS). Obese children spent more time doing sedentary activities (400 +/- 129 vs. 295 +/- 127 min; p < 0.05) and less time in nonsedentary activities (449 +/- 126 vs. 563 +/- 135 min; p < 0.05) than nonobese children. Time spent in moderate or vigorous activity-i.e., time spent at a HR between 50% of the maximal O2 uptake (peak VO2) and 70% peak VO2 (moderate) and at a HR > or = 70% peak VO2 (vigorous)-was not statistically different in obese and nonobese children (88 +/- 69 vs. 52 +/- 35 min and 20 +/- 21 vs. 16 +/- 13 min, respectively; p = NS). TEE was significantly higher in the obese group than in the nonobese group (9.46 +/- 1.40 vs. 7.51 +/- 1.67 MJ/day; p < 0.01). The energy expenditure for physical activity (plus thermogenesis) was significantly higher in the obese children (3.98 +/- 1.30 vs. 2.94 +/- 1.39 MJ/day; p < 0.05). The proportion of TEE daily devoted to physical activity (plus thermogenesis) was not significantly different in the two groups, as shown by the ratio between TEE and the postabsorptive metabolic rate (PMR): 1.72 +/- 0.25 obese vs 1.61 +/- 0.28 non-obese. In conclusion, in free-living conditions obese children have a higher TEE than do nonobese children, despite the greater time devoted to sedentary activities. The higher energy cost to perform weight-bearing activities as well as the higher absolute PMR of obese children help explain this apparent paradox.

This review aims at identifying gaps in knowledge on socioeconomic gradients in mortality in the oldest old. The authors review literature on oldest old population with a focus on unanswered questions: do socioeconomic status (SES) gradients in mortality persist after 80; does the magnitude of the gradient change as compared with younger populations; which socioeconomic/socio-demographic determinants should be used in this population with specific characteristics (e.g., with respect to sex ratio and household type)? Results are often inconsistent while conclusions drawn by selected studies are generally limited by the difficulty of disentangling the effects of age and cohort, and of generalizing results observed in preponderantly small, selected samples (which typically exclude institutionalized persons). Future research should explore the effects of socio-demographic indicators other than education and social class (e.g., marital status, loss of the partner) and adequately differentiate the social position of oldest old women. The authors recommend that research applies a life-course perspective combined with an interdisciplinary perspective to improve our understanding of the SES gradients in later life. Research is needed to elucidate which causal pathways depending on SES in younger age impact on mortality in higher ages up to oldest old.

Antibodies to human T-cell lymphotropic virus-1 and 2 (HTLV-1 and 2) were tested in 259 inhabitants (98 males and 161 females) of four villages of the Marajó Island (Pará, Brazil) using enzyme immunoassays (ELISA and Western blot). Types and subtypes of HTLV were determined by nested polymerase chain reaction (PCR) targeting the pX, env and 5´LTR regions. HTLV-1 infection was detected in Santana do Arari (2.06%) and Ponta de Pedras (1%). HTLV-2 was detected only in Santana do Arari (1.06%). Sequencing of the 5´LTR region of HTLV-1 and the phylogenetic analysis identified the virus as a member of the Cosmopolitan Group, subgroup Transcontinental. Santana do Arari is an Afro-Brazilian community and the current results represent the first report of HTLV-1 infection in a mocambo located in the Brazilian Amazon region.

The main viruses involved in acute respiratory diseases among children are: respiratory syncytial virus (RSV), influenzavirus (FLU), parainfluenzavirus (PIV), adenovirus (AdV), human rhinovirus (HRV), and the human metapneumovirus (hMPV). The purpose of the present study was to identify respiratory viruses that affected children younger than five years old in Uberlândia, Midwestern Brazil. Nasopharyngeal aspirates from 379 children attended at Hospital de Clínicas (HC/UFU), from 2001 to 2004, with acute respiratory disease, were collected and tested by immunofluorescence assay (IFA) to detect RSV, FLU A and B, PIV 1, 2, and 3 and AdV, and RT-PCR to detect HRV. RSV was detected in 26.4% (100/379) of samples, FLU A and B in 9.5% (36/379), PIV 1, 2 and 3 in 6.3% (24/379) and AdV in 3.7% (14/379). HRV were detected in 29.6% (112/379) of the negative and indeterminate samples tested by IFI. RSV, particularly among children less than six months of life, and HRV cases showed highest incidence. Negative samples by both IFA and RT-PCR might reflect the presence of other pathogens, such as hMPV, coronavirus, and bacteria. Laboratorial diagnosis constituted an essential instrument to determine the incidence of the most common viruses in respiratory infections among children in this region.
